COURSING

The Canterbury Cap meeting was held at yesterday, In wether that war s'l that could be deßlred. Mr Chattels acted a* Jud .j. ; Messrs Calvert and Lembef took the slips. A goodly number of spectators was prcaant. Hares were very plentiful, but were wild. Following are results: Canterbury Cop, Ist round. Bohemian Girl beat Lady of the L .ke. Marora beat Symphony Salamauder was absent, and Ooomaisie ran a bye. Juvenile Plate Ist round. Wakannl beat Ballarat Seaihell beat Mollis Bawn Wakata beit Bendigo Seilor Boy beat Heather Ball Kknsi-gton Stakes. Ist round. Paradox beat Molly

No other events than the above were got off yesterday, but coursing will be resumed at 8 o’clock th's morning.
